Pursuant to DepEd Order No. 89, s. 2012, there is a massive advocacy campaign for the early registration starting ianuary 7, 2013 and the early registration day for Sy 2013-2014 for the new enrollees is lanuary 26, 2013.

2.

lnclosure No. 1 of this memorandum is intended to be used during the preenrolment period to gather data that will help the school heads in making decision on which program to offer per clientele and to address the needs and problems of the schools. The Division/District and school officials are strongly advised to coordinate and seek assistance for advocacies and collection of data and other needed support from Local Government Unit Offices - (Planning Officer, Ba.angay Health Workers, Local Registrar, Sanggunian Kabataan, Barangay Captain and other Officials incharge of Education), BSP, GSP, Rotary Club, Philippine Chamber of Commerce, Jaycees, different Church Organizations and other NGOs and National Government
Agencies (NGAs).

3.

4.

Schools are advised to use different forms of local media for advocacy such as tarpaulin display, public announcement, radio broadcast, local TV channel, and other medium.

5.

All Registration forms for kindergarten, Grades 1-6 and Years 1to 4, ADM5 and ALS should be submitted to the Division Office on lanuary 28, 2013 and should be forwarded to DepEd Central Office, Office of the Planning Service (OPS) and Research and Statistics Office copy furnished the Regional Office not later than February 1,2013. Likewise, Division Report on School Needs should be submitted to the Central Office and Regional Office not later than March 8, 2013.
